    Product Specifications:
  • MfrPart.: FJX3005RTF
  • Mfr: onsemi
  • Description: TRANS PREBIAS NPN 200MW SOT323
  • Product Category: Discrete Semiconductor Products~Transistors - Bipolar (BJT) - Single, Pre-Biased
  • Package: Tape & Reel (TR)
  • Series: -
  • PartStatus: Obsolete
  • TransistorType: NPN - Pre-Biased
  • Current-Collector(Ic)(Max): 100 mA
  • Voltage-CollectorEmitterBreakdown(Max): 50 V
  • Resistor-Base(R1): 4.7 kOhms
  • Resistor-EmitterBase(R2): 10 kOhms
  • DCCurrentGain(hFE)(Min)@IcVce: 30 @ 5mA, 5V
  • VceSaturation(Max)@IbIc: 300mV @ 500µA, 10mA
  • Current-CollectorCutoff(Max): 100nA (ICBO)
  • Frequency-Transition: 250 MHz
  • Power-Max: 200 mW
  • MountingType: Surface Mount
  • Package/Case: SC-70, SOT-323
